The Woodlot Restaurant Review:



About the restaurant & décor: In the spot where VYNL laid claim for many years, The Woodlot reaches out to locals and theatergoers alike with a meandering menu of international comfort food. The room exudes warmth with rough wood walls and closely set wood tables and booths. Diners all seem to be from the neighborhood, as conversation is lively at the bar as well as at the tables.

Likes: Cozy choice for pre- or post-theater dining.
Dislikes: Tables are very close together.

Food & Drinks: An artisanal cocktail list follows the vogue of mixing multiple ingredients and textures in each glass, and the craft beer is pure Americana. Even the pickiest eater will find something to choose from on the largely small-plate menu. Try the crispy shrimp spiked with sesame seeds and citrus mayo, or the generously portioned fried Brussels sprouts finished with Caesar dressing. “Big plates” of General Tso’s chicken, Scottish salmon or ahi tuna poke are there for the hungriest. But if you prefer something more New York-centric, try chef Jason Neroni's oversized burgers or his five deep dish pizzas --- the Godzilla with its four-meat and double cheese topping lives up to its name. A dozen wines by the glass span the globe and include two Italians on tap.
